CSS外链式导入:高效利用外部样式表提升网站性能与可维护性346


在CSS样式表的使用中,外链法是一种非常常见且高效的引入外部样式表的方式。相比于内联式和嵌入式,外链法具有诸多优势,能够显著提升网站的性能、可维护性和可复用性。本文将详细讲解CSS外链法的使用方法、优缺点以及最佳实践,帮助大家更好地理解和应用这种重要的CSS技术。

什么是CSS外链法?

CSS外链法是指将CSS样式代码独立存储在一个单独的`.css`文件中,然后通过``标签在HTML文档中引用该文件。这种方法将样式与内容分离,使得HTML文档更加简洁易读,并且方便样式的维护和复用。一个网站可以引用多个外部CSS文件,从而实现更复杂的样式效果。

如何使用CSS外链法?

使用外链法引入外部样式表非常简单,只需要在HTML文档的``标签内添加以下代码:<link rel="stylesheet" type="text/css" href="">

其中:
rel="stylesheet":指定该链接是一个样式表。
type="text/css":指定链接文件的类型为CSS。
href="":指定外部CSS文件的路径。路径可以是相对路径或绝对路径。相对路径相对于HTML文件所在目录;绝对路径则是完整的URL地址。

例如,如果你的``文件位于与HTML文件相同的目录下,则可以使用相对路径`href=""`;如果``文件位于`css`文件夹下,则可以使用相对路径`href="css/"`。如果``文件位于不同的服务器上,则需要使用绝对路径,例如`href="/css/"`。

你可以根据需要在``标签中添加多个``标签来引用多个外部CSS文件。浏览器会按照``标签出现的顺序加载这些样式表,后加载的样式表会覆盖前面加载的样式表中相同的样式规则。

外链法的优点:
提高页面加载速度: 浏览器可以缓存外部CSS文件。当用户访问其他使用相同CSS文件的页面时,浏览器可以直接从缓存中读取,从而加快页面加载速度。
增强可维护性: 将样式代码与HTML内容分离,方便修改和维护样式代码。修改CSS文件后,所有引用该文件的页面都会自动更新样式,无需逐个修改HTML文件。
提高可复用性: 外部CSS文件可以被多个HTML页面复用,减少代码冗余,提高开发效率。
改善代码组织结构: 将CSS代码分离到独立的文件中,使得HTML代码更加简洁,易于阅读和理解,提高代码的可读性。
有利于SEO优化: 将CSS分离能够让搜索引擎更好地抓取网站内容,提高网站SEO排名。


外链法的缺点:
增加HTTP请求: 使用外链法需要额外的HTTP请求来加载CSS文件,这可能会略微增加页面加载时间,不过现代浏览器都有缓存机制,可以有效缓解这个问题。
依赖外部文件: 如果外部CSS文件无法加载,页面样式可能会出现问题。所以选择可靠的服务器和备份方案至关重要。


最佳实践:
使用压缩和最小化CSS文件: 压缩和最小化CSS文件可以减小文件大小,从而提高页面加载速度。
使用CDN加速: 将CSS文件部署到CDN (内容分发网络)上,可以减少用户访问CSS文件的延迟。
合理组织CSS文件: 对于大型网站,可以将CSS文件按照模块进行划分,例如:, , , 等,方便管理和维护。
规范命名: 使用清晰、易于理解的文件名和类名,提高代码的可读性和可维护性。
使用CSS预处理器: 使用Sass、Less等CSS预处理器可以提高CSS代码的可维护性和可扩展性。


总而言之,CSS外链法是构建高质量网站的重要组成部分。它能有效地提高网站性能、可维护性和可复用性。 通过合理运用外链法以及相关的最佳实践,可以有效地提升用户体验,并简化网站的开发和维护工作。

2025-05-27


上一篇:外链代发:风险与收益并存的SEO灰色地带

下一篇:CSS外链法详解:高效引入样式表提升网页性能